Student learning outcomes
Graduates in graphic design will:
- Demonstrate technical proficiency using professional design software.
- Use principles of design and typography to create effective visual communication.
- Be able to define and assess communication goals and design appropriate and creative solutions at a professional level.
- Demonstrate preparedness to incorporate design into their lives after graduation in a variety of ways, within or in addition to a career.

Planning and advising notes
At least one, but no more than two studio art courses are recommended per semester. At least 75 non-art credit hours are required for a Goshen College degree.
